Abstract
Higher order thinking skills (HOTS) are there upper cognitive processes of bloom’ s revised
taxonomy by Anderson and Krathwohl (2021) which consist off analyzing, evaluating, and
creating. This research aimed to investigate the composition of HOTS (Higher Order
Thinking Skill) in language tasks and knowledge of the English textbook on titled “Pathway”
To English For SMA/MA Grade X and to explain the dominant cognitive dimension used in
this textbook. The design of this research was descriptive qualitative. This research is
classified as a content analysis. A table checklist based on the cognitive domain of the revised
Bloom’s taxonomy was the instrument of this research. The findings of the research indicate
that for language skills, this book is more concerned with HOT than LOTS with the
percentage of HOTS at 58,34% and LOTS at 41,66%. The result showed The most dominant
level of thinking skill of language skill in this book is analyze (C4), followed by apply (C3),
remember (C1), create (C6), evaluate (C5), and understand (C2). For knowledge, it can be
concluded that the composition of the Higher Order Thinking Skill (HOTS) presented in the
instruction question on the English Textbook is not lower than the Lower Order Thinking
Skill (LOTS) with the percentage of HOTS at 20,83% and LOTS at 79,17%. The dominant
composition is Apply (C3), followed by Remember (C1), Apply (C4), and Understand (C2).
The researcher concludes that for language skill and knowledge, the cognitive dimension of
each instruction question is present in the imbalance portion. Based on the result, this book
has followed the ministry of education regulation and mereka curriculum in providing HOTS
material in the teaching and learning process for language skills and proving LOTS material
for knowledge because grammar and vocabulary teach the basics of language. It is suggested
for teachers who use this book to be innovative, and creative, even teachers can adapt from
other sources in giving instruction to develop students’ critical thinking.
